#include "cuda_runtime.h"
#include "device_launch_parameters.h"
#include <stdio.h>
#include <iostream>
//----------------------------------------------------------------------------------------------------
//声明为__global__ 表明这个函数是在设备上运行,而不是主机上。
//同时这个函数将被交给编译设备代码的编译器
//而main函数则是交给主机编译器
//尖括号表示要将一些参数传递给运行时系统,这些参数并不是传递给设备代码的参数
//而是告诉运行时如何启动设备代码
__global__ void kernel( )
{
}
int main()
{
//int c;
//int* dev_c;
kernel<<<1,1>>>();
printf("Hello World");
getchar();
return 0;
}
__global__ void add(int a, int b , int* c)
{
*c = a + b;
}
CUDA-Code1-HelloWorld
最新推荐文章于 2022-06-06 20:43:40 发布